├── .babelrc ├── .gitignore ├── LICENSE ├── README.md ├── dist ├── vue-paginate.js └── vue-paginate.min.js ├── examples ├── App.vue ├── index.html └── main.js ├── karma.conf.js ├── package.json ├── src ├── components │ ├── Paginate.js │ └── PaginateLinks.js ├── config │ └── linkTypes.js ├── index.js └── util │ ├── LimitedLinksGenerator.js │ ├── debug.js │ └── paginateDataGenerator.js ├── test ├── LimitedLinksGenerator.js ├── Paginate.js ├── PaginateLinks.js └── paginateDataGenerator.js ├── webpack.config.js └── yarn.lock /.babelrc: -------------------------------------------------------------------------------- 1 | { 2 | "presets": ["es2015"] 3 | } -------------------------------------------------------------------------------- /.gitignore: -------------------------------------------------------------------------------- 1 | .DS_Store 2 | node_modules/ 3 | npm-debug.log -------------------------------------------------------------------------------- /LICENSE: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TahaSh/vue-paginate/HEAD/LICENSE -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TahaSh/vue-paginate/HEAD/README.md -------------------------------------------------------------------------------- /dist/vue-paginate.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TahaSh/vue-paginate/HEAD/dist/vue-paginate.js -------------------------------------------------------------------------------- /dist/vue-paginate.min.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TahaSh/vue-paginate/HEAD/dist/vue-paginate.min.js -------------------------------------------------------------------------------- /examples/App.vue: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TahaSh/vue-paginate/HEAD/examples/App.vue -------------------------------------------------------------------------------- /examples/index.html: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TahaSh/vue-paginate/HEAD/examples/index.html -------------------------------------------------------------------------------- /examples/main.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TahaSh/vue-paginate/HEAD/examples/main.js -------------------------------------------------------------------------------- /karma.conf.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TahaSh/vue-paginate/HEAD/karma.conf.js -------------------------------------------------------------------------------- /package.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TahaSh/vue-paginate/HEAD/package.json -------------------------------------------------------------------------------- /src/components/Paginate.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TahaSh/vue-paginate/HEAD/src/components/Paginate.js -------------------------------------------------------------------------------- /src/components/PaginateLinks.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TahaSh/vue-paginate/HEAD/src/components/PaginateLinks.js -------------------------------------------------------------------------------- /src/config/linkTypes.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TahaSh/vue-paginate/HEAD/src/config/linkTypes.js -------------------------------------------------------------------------------- /src/index.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TahaSh/vue-paginate/HEAD/src/index.js -------------------------------------------------------------------------------- /src/util/LimitedLinksGenerator.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TahaSh/vue-paginate/HEAD/src/util/LimitedLinksGenerator.js -------------------------------------------------------------------------------- /src/util/debug.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TahaSh/vue-paginate/HEAD/src/util/debug.js -------------------------------------------------------------------------------- /src/util/paginateDataGenerator.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TahaSh/vue-paginate/HEAD/src/util/paginateDataGenerator.js -------------------------------------------------------------------------------- /test/LimitedLinksGenerator.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TahaSh/vue-paginate/HEAD/test/LimitedLinksGenerator.js -------------------------------------------------------------------------------- /test/Paginate.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TahaSh/vue-paginate/HEAD/test/Paginate.js -------------------------------------------------------------------------------- /test/PaginateLinks.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TahaSh/vue-paginate/HEAD/test/PaginateLinks.js -------------------------------------------------------------------------------- /test/paginateDataGenerator.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TahaSh/vue-paginate/HEAD/test/paginateDataGenerator.js -------------------------------------------------------------------------------- /webpack.config.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TahaSh/vue-paginate/HEAD/webpack.config.js -------------------------------------------------------------------------------- /yarn.lock: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/TahaSh/vue-paginate/HEAD/yarn.lock --------------------------------------------------------------------------------